RUGBY

AN ATTRACTIVE PROGRAMME. A very attractive programme will be put on at Athletic Park this afternoon. Oriental, who have had several successive credilablo victories, meet the clover Petone combination, now the leading team, l'etone's latest effort in defeating Trontham stamps them as champions. Tho town club is reported lo'have the services of Skinner (their old wing forward and a Wellington and.Otago representative), and Paierson, a smart three-quar-ter a few sensens back. The meeting of Wellington College and Old Boys on No. 2 ground should also bo an attractive game.

A very interesting fifth class match takes place nt 1.30 p.m., when Scots College meets Wnllington College. At Petono, two of the leading senior teams, Athletic and Poneke, meet at tho Recreation Ground. The Athletic and Hutt fifth class mutch nt Hntt Becrontion Ground will bo played at 1.45 p.m.
